Design

Electric scooters have been engineered to be slim and compact which allows them to fold down or up in a matter of minutes. They also come with features like brakes, as well as a display panel that allow you to control your ride and track vital information such as battery life and speed. The seat and handles can be adjusted to your height for maximum comfort and safety.

Batteries, typically Li-ion are used to green power the scooter. These batteries are located at the base of the scooter in order to keep the center of gravity down. This enhances stability.

There are two primary kinds of greenpower electric scooters scooters - kick-powered and bike-style. Kick-powered scooters have a narrow platform that allows the user to stand and holds the handlebar, while bike-style scooters feature an open frame and a comfortable seat to ride on.

Depending on the kind of scooter you pick the most important factors to consider include rider weight, battery capacity, motor power and braking system. A motor with more power will allow for heavier riders without a decrease in performance, while a larger battery can provide more power. A more powerful motor allows for faster speeds and steeper slopes.

Braking systems can be classified as electronic and mechanical systems ones, with the former being more efficient and requires less maintenance. A mechanical braking system employs physical mechanisms such as discs drum, foot and disc brakes to slow the scooter down while electronic systems make use of a combination of sensors and controllers to control the flow of current to the motor in accordance with the accelerator input. Both types of brake systems are vital for safety and control. Electrical braking systems are more durable than mechanical ones, especially in bad weather.

Maintenance

If you take care of your electric scooter, it will last longer and perform better than one that is not taken care of. By ensuring regular cleaning and lubrication routines, as well as regular inspections to keep your scooter in top shape and looking beautiful. A well-maintained, well-riding scooter will make you glad to ride it and retain its value should you decide to sell it.

The first step in maintaining is to clean the scooter thoroughly. This will help get rid of dust and dirt from the electrical components that are sensitive. Electricity and water should not be mixed while cleaning. Avoid using too much water, and always use an item that is safe for electronic devices. Afterwards, be sure to dry the scooter prior to reassembling it.

Brakes are a crucial component of electric scooters It is a good idea to inspect them on a regular basis for wear and tear. You may have to replace the brake pads or adjust the caliper. You can find all the details in the owner's manual for your particular braking system. Make sure you read this before you attempt any repairs.

It is also a good idea to examine the tire pressure on a regular basis. If the tires are not properly inflated, it can affect the handling and battery performance of the scooter. Check the kickstand to ensure it is working properly.

If you aren't at ease doing these repairs yourself, it is a good idea to find an electric scooter repair shop close to you. These shops have the expertise and equipment to fix a variety of problems. They can also perform repairs quickly.

Disposal

As electric scooters increase in popularity as a mode of transportation, companies must ensure that their end-of-life disposal practices are sustainable and aligned with the environment's sustainability. This involves recycling or reusing batteries as well as other components by implementing sustainable eWaste practices. Since private and rideshare scooters generally change hands annually it is an important aspect to be considered for long-term success on the market.

The separation and recovery from complex assemblies is one of the most challenging aspects of recycling electric scooters. Batteries, for instance, comprise of a variety of elements that must be separated and disassembled before they can be reused. This process can be lengthy and costly, yet it's crucial to reduce waste in the environment and create the concept of a circular economy.

A second issue is the possibility of leaks or fires occurring during recycling. This is particularly true for lithium-ion battery, which requires specialized facilities with advanced safety and containment methods. This issue can be resolved by the implementation of strict protocols for storing and collecting used batteries, as well as transporting them to recycling facilities.

The good news is, a growing awareness about green power electric mobility scooter living and advancements in recycling technology allow for easier recycling of components and scooters. Manufacturers are also taking part in this effort, designing scooters with recyclability and safer materials in mind.
